### Running latest version from source code checkout
|
||||
|
||||
If you can't use Python package or native package for your OS is outdated you
|
||||
can clone the repo and run asciinema straight from the checkout.
|
||||
|
||||
Clone the repo:
|
||||
|
||||
git clone https://github.com/asciinema/asciinema.git
|
||||
cd asciinema
|
||||
|
||||
If you want latest stable version:
|
||||
|
||||
git checkout master
|
||||
|
||||
If you want current development version:
|
||||
|
||||
git checkout develop
|
||||
|
||||
Then run it with:
|
||||
|
||||
python3 -m asciinema --version
